How Cotton Kills Your Bear?
Cotton absorbs water, and the fibres that make cotton up stick together when they're wet. So it will hold a massive amount of water again your bear skin. And it will not insulate the heat at all. Cotton is the worst fabric to get wet in cold or even mild temperatures. If this is true, getting those wet and then wandering around for even under an hour could prove fatal for brandon.
